SYDNEY MURDER CHARGE

VERDICT OP NOT GUILTY. STATEMENT. BY THE ACCUSED. Press Association.—By Telegraph-Copyright SYDNEY. Juno 18. (Received Jimp 18, at 11.5 p.m. Hi's ISaikie, who i s charged villi the murder of Ale-sunder Brown, in the course of_ a lengthy statement from tlio box, Said the bought aixpennyworth of arsenic, but Brown took it from* her and threw ii in the fire, saying it. OTI3 t o o dangerous to have tliero. That was all she'know of the poison. She declared that Brown drank quantities of alo and spirits, but would not take doctors' medicine. She did all filio could for his health. The jury rutiro;! at 6.30 p.m. (Received June 19, at 0.12 a.m.) The Jury -found -Mrs Baikie not guilty.
